An important life lesson for teenagers is learning how to respond to unfavorable circumstances. Although bad things happen to everyone in life, how you handle them can have a significant effect on how you feel today and in the future.

The first and most important thing to do in a bad situation is to recognize and accept your sentiments. Let go of judgment and give yourself permission to feel and process any feelings you are feeling, including fear, anger, irritation, and grief. Stress and emotional distress might worsen, if you deny or repress your emotions.

Consider the circumstances for a moment, and think, before acting. Think about the underlying causes of the negativity and assess your first reaction. Gaining perspective and responding more intelligently and skillfully can be achieved by taking a step back.

Remain self-compassionate when facing hardship. Treat yourself well and refrain from criticizing or holding yourself responsible for the unfavorable circumstance. Be kind and understanding to yourself as you would, to a friend going through a similar situation. Self-compassion could support you in overcoming adversity, with fortitude and grace.

Even in the face of adversity, practice thankfulness. Pay attention to your life’s blessings and the things you have, no matter how little. Think about others, in worse situations. Gratitude exercises could help you change your perspective and foster resilience in the face of adversity. Every bad circumstance offers a chance for development and learning. Think carefully about the lessons you could draw from the event, and how you might utilize them to fortify and bolster your resilience. Accept obstacles as chances for growth and development of the self.

Teenagers could acquire useful coping mechanisms that will benefit them for the rest of their life, by learning how to respond to difficult circumstances, with self-awareness, compassion, and resilience. Unavoidably, bad things will happen to you; you will face life challenges and difficulties; but how you handle them, will ultimately define your capacity to rise above hardship and prosper in the face of difficulties.

Like, is said: adversity breeds opportunity.
